ubuntu查看时间 ubuntu哪个版本最好

如何在 Ubuntu 上设置时间同步

在Ubuntu系统中,保持时间同步至关重要,尤其是对于依赖定时任务和日志管理的系统。以下是设置Ubuntu时间同步的详细步骤:

首先,确认当前的时区。使用`date`命令查看,如输出所示:

如果需要更改时区,可以使用`timedatectl`或`tzdata`命令。例如,想将时区设置为CST(中国标准时间),运行:

对于旧版Ubuntu,没有`timedatectl`,则可通过`tzdata`选择对应城市,如Kolkata:

对于不习惯命令行操作的用户,可以在图形界面设置。通过Ubuntu Dash搜索“settings”,选择“日期与时间”选项,启用“自动时区”即可。

此外,检查并确保timesyncd服务同步时间。若状态不正常,重启服务后观察:

通过上述操作,你的Ubuntu系统时钟将与互联网时间服务器保持同步,确保定时任务和日志管理等关键功能正常运行。

Ubuntu查看磁盘信息的命令

在Ubuntu系统中,有多种命令可以用来查看磁盘信息。这些命令可以让你深入了解计算机上的磁盘情况,从而进行更有效的管理。

首先,使用lsblk命令可以列出计算机上所有已连接的物理硬盘。通过执行lsblk命令,你可以看到计算机上的所有磁盘,包括它们的类型和大小。

其次,df命令提供有关磁盘空间使用情况的信息。使用df命令,你可以查看每个磁盘上的可用空间、已用空间和剩余空间。这对于管理存储空间和避免空间不足的情况非常重要。

top命令提供了一个实时的系统性能概览,包括CPU使用情况、内存使用情况以及运行进程的详细信息。通过分析top命令输出中的wa百分比,你可以了解当前磁盘I/O等待时间的占用情况,从而判断磁盘性能是否出现瓶颈。

此外,iotop命令是一个专门用于监控进程的磁盘I/O使用情况的工具。通过使用iotop命令,你可以发现哪些进程或线程消耗了大量磁盘I/O资源,从而针对性地进行优化或调整。

以上这些命令和工具在Ubuntu系统中都是常用的磁盘信息查看工具,它们有助于用户更好地管理和优化系统性能,提升计算机的运行效率。

ubuntu怎么看开机时间

一般是使用uptime命令,直接输入uptime即可:

04:03:58 up 10 days, 13:19, 1 user, load average: 0.54, 0.40, 0.20

uptime命令是用来查询linux系统负载的!

用法:直接输入uptime即可.

另外还有一个参数-v(大写)

是用来查询版本的

[root@ localhost]$ uptime–V(大写)

procps version 3.2.7

以下显示输入uptime的信息:

04:03:58 up 10 days, 13:19, 1 user, load average: 0.54, 0.40, 0.20

1.当前时间 04:03:58

2.系统已运行的时间 10 days, 13:19

3.前在线用户 1 user

4.平均负载:0.54, 0.40, 0.20

最近1分钟、5分钟、15分钟系统的负载

何为系统负载呢?

uptime命令是用来查询linux系统负载的!

用法:直接输入uptime即可.

另外还有一个参数-v

是用来查询版本的

[root@ localhost]$ uptime–V

procps version 3.2.7

以下显示输入uptime的信息:

04:03:58 up 10 days, 13:19, 1 user, load average: 0.54, 0.40, 0.20

1.当前时间 04:03:58

2.系统已运行的时间 10 days, 13:19

3.但前在线用户 1 user

4.平均负载:0.54, 0.40, 0.20

最近1分钟、5分钟、15分钟系统的负载

何为系统负载呢?

系统平均负载被定义为在特定时间间隔内运行队列中的平均进程树。如果一个进程满足以下条件则其就会位于运行队列中:

-它没有在等待I/O操作的结果

-它没有主动进入等待状态(也就是没有调用'wait')

-没有被停止(例如:等待终止)

一般来说,每个CPU内核当前活动进程数不大于3,则系统运行表现良好!当然这里说的是每个cpu内核,也就是如果你的主机是四核cpu的话,那么只要uptime最后输出的一串字符数值小于12即表示系统负载不是很严重.

当然如果达到20,那就表示当前系统负载非常严重,估计打开执行web脚本非常缓慢.

这里建议大家可以使用php探针来实现!这个可以检测空间商提供的linux主机负载情况!

★ps进程管理

[root@localhost~]# ps-ef

UID PID PPID C STIME TTY TIME CMD

root 1 0 0 Jul02? 00:00:06 init [5]

root 2 1 0 Jul02? 00:00:00 [migration/0]

root 3 1 0 Jul02? 00:00:00 [ksoftirqd/0]

root 4 1 0 Jul02? 00:00:00 [watchdog/0]

root 5 1 0 Jul02? 00:00:00 [migration/1]

root 6 1 0 Jul02? 00:00:00 [ksoftirqd/1]

root 7 1 0 Jul02? 00:00:00 [watchdog/1]

root 8 1 0 Jul02? 00:00:00 [migration/2]

root 9 1 0 Jul02? 00:00:00 [ksoftirqd/2]

-e:在命令执行后显示环境

-f:完整显示输出

1)进程用户ID(UID)

2)进程ID(PID)

3)父进程ID(PPID)

4) CPU调度情况(C)

5)进程启动的时间(STIME)

6)进程共占用CPU的时间(TIME)

7)启动进程的命令(CMD)

★关于/proc/uptime

/proc/uptime文件里包含两个数字,如:

[root@localhost~]# cat/proc/uptime

1232468.44 1111331.67

第一个数值代表系统总的启动时间,第二个数值则代表系统空闲的时间,都是用秒来表示的。如果系统里第二个数字比第一个数字还要大,则说明你的cpu是多核的,cpu0上闲了一秒, cpu1上闲了两秒,加起就是三秒。。

阅读剩余
THE END